1. Allow sign-up with social media accounts — one-click registration Using existing social media accounts to sign-up for a new application is becoming popular among users. This provides the user a quick and efficient process to get registered without going into the hassle of creating a new account and providing all the information from scratch.

In many cases, the signup page is the last step in a business's conversion funnel. It's where prospects navigate after they've evaluated a brand and decided its service offers what they need. Because of that, signup pages focus less on persuading the prospect to convert and more on minimizing the friction involved in doing it.
